Piy*_*iya 0 html javascript jquery
<form action ="one.php" method="post">
<input type="radio" name="cardType" id="one" class="css-checkbox" value="db">
<input type="radio" name="cardType" id="two" class="css-checkbox" value="cc">
<div id="a">Hi</div>
<div id="b">Hellow</div>
</form>
Run Code Online (Sandbox Code Playgroud)
我有一个表单,其中有两个单选按钮和两个div.如果我选择id = 1的单选按钮,则显示id为"a"的div,并显示其他div,其他div将被隐藏,表单操作将为one.php.如果我选择id ="two"的单选按钮,将显示id ="b"的div并将表单操作更改为"two.php"..如何使用jquery或javascript.Any帮助完成此操作.
<form id="myForm" action ="one.php" method="post">
<input type="radio" name="cardType" id="one" class="css-checkbox" value="db" checked>
<input type="radio" name="cardType" id="two" class="css-checkbox" value="cc">
<div id="a">Hi</div>
<div id="b">Hellow</div>
</form>
css:
#b{
display:none;
}
Script
$(document).ready(function () {
$(".css-checkbox").click(function () {
if ($(this).attr('id') == "one") {
$('#a').show();
$('#b').hide();
$("#myForm").attr('action','one.php');
} else {
$('#a').hide();
$('#b').show();
$("#myForm").attr('action','two.php');
}
});
});
Run Code Online (Sandbox Code Playgroud)